The Mechanics of Disposable Vapes
A disposable vape typically consists of a few essential components: a battery, an atomizer, and a pre-filled e-liquid reservoir. The battery heats the e-liquid in the atomizer, creating vapor for the user to inhale. Most disposable vapes are designed for a limited number of puffs, after which they are discarded.
One of the notable features of these devices is their compact size, making them easy to carry around. Users appreciate the convenience, as they can easily slip a disposable vape in their pocket or bag without worrying about leaks or spillage.
The Environmental Impact
While disposable vapes have become increasingly popular, they raise significant environmental concerns. The improper disposal of these devices contributes to electronic waste, which can take years to decompose. Many users are unaware that the lithium batteries inside these vapes pose a significant environmental hazard if not disposed of correctly.
To address this issue, some manufacturers are exploring biodegradable materials for their disposable vapes. Initiatives to create recycling programs specifically for vape products are also in development. However, there remains a long journey ahead for the industry to become genuinely sustainable.
Health Implications of Disposable Vapes
Research into the health effects of vaping is still emerging, but some studies suggest that disposable vapes may pose risks similar to those associated with traditional smoking. Users should be aware of the ingredients found in e-liquids, which can include nicotine, propylene glycol, vegetable glycerin, and various flavoring agents.
The lack of regulation in the vaping industry has led to varying product quality, with some disposable vapes containing harmful substances. It is critical for consumers to educate themselves about the products they choose and opt for brands that provide transparent ingredient lists.

Questions About Disposable Vapes
1. Are disposable vapes safer than traditional cigarettes?
The consensus among health professionals is that while disposable vapes may be less harmful than traditional cigarettes, they are not without risks. Vaping still exposes users to nicotine and various chemicals. Ultimately, the safest option for health is to avoid both smoking and vaping altogether.
2. How do I properly dispose of a disposable vape?
To properly dispose of a disposable vape, check for local recycling programs that accept lithium batteries and electronic waste. Some manufacturers also offer take-back programs. Never throw these devices in regular trash, as they can contribute to environmental pollution.
3. Can using disposable vapes lead to long-term addiction?
Yes, many disposable vapes contain high levels of nicotine, which can lead to addiction. Users should approach vaping with caution, particularly if they have never used nicotine products before. Reducing usage or seeking help to quit can be beneficial for those who find themselves addicted.
